Output 11f80bcf6e3ba5716121d9c8ee35cb9546803f2a080d0f2c817480dda44e2895:23

value
6617380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ab113b29e1bd9a4c11456fcf73dd383b27071fb3 OP_EQUAL
address
3HHY7atajKWUfb8UZgNmJMtFRnyQFtbxrS
transaction
11f80bcf6e3ba5716121d9c8ee35cb9546803f2a080d0f2c817480dda44e2895
spent
true